PRTH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2023 in Review

33 of the 6,869 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Priority Technology Holdings (PRTH) for Q4 2023, worth a combined $31.1M — up 9.7% from $28.3M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 4 funds closed out of PRTH and 1 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 8 trimmed existing stakes and 14 added.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$138K. The largest seller was TimesSquare Capital Management, cutting an estimated $355K.
